Set off from Dubrovnik for a full-day adventure exploring the stunning Adriatic coast of Montenegro. Your journey begins with a convenient hotel pickup, followed by a scenic drive along the picturesque Bay of Kotor, offering breathtaking views and a chance to relax before your first stop.
Pause in the charming town of Herceg Novi for a brief break, then continue to the historic village of Perast. Here, enjoy a peaceful boat ride to the unique Island of Our Lady of the Rocks, where you can visit the island’s church and museum and learn about its fascinating origins.
Next, arrive in the walled city of Kotor for a guided walking tour through its UNESCO-listed old town. You’ll have time to explore the cobbled streets, discover local shops, and soak up the atmosphere before heading to your next destination.
After a short drive, stop at a panoramic viewpoint above Sveti Stefan, the iconic islet resort, perfect for capturing memorable photos. Continue to Budva, where you can enjoy free time for lunch and explore this lively seaside town at your own pace.
